When It’s Time to Get Your Air Conditioning Repaired

Is the level of comfort in your house falling short of what you would like it to be? There are other, more subtle issues that, if disregarded, might lead to more extreme repair work or the need for an early replacement of your air conditioning system. While a system that will not turn on is a clear indication that you need repair work, there are other, less apparent issues. If you are familiar with the more subtle signs of a problem with your a/c, you will be able to call a professional service expert quicker rather than later.

If any of the following use, one of our Kansas AC repair experts recommends that you give us a call:

  • You are sustaining an boost in the quantity of cash needed to pay for your month-to-month utility bills: Inefficient operation of your air conditioning system can be triggered by a number of various issues, including leaking ductwork, an internal breakdown, or a faulty thermostat. This means that it has to work more difficult to keep your home cool, which will lead to a substantial boost in the amount that you pay in energy expenses.
  • You only see hot air coming out of your vents: First things first, make certain you haven’t accidentally set the thermostat to the inaccurate temperature level by examining it. If that is not the case, then you most likely have a issue on the inside of your air conditioning unit, and you ought to get it checked by a professional.
  • You are seeing a higher humidity level at your home: Even though this is not the primary function of your a/c, it is accountable for regulating the humidity level inside of your home or industrial structure. Greater humidity shows that there is an excess of moisture in the air, which can lead to the development of mold and mildew in addition to making the air feel warm and sticky. It is essential that you get this matter resolved as quickly as humanly practical, particularly for the sake of your security.
  • The airflow in your system is inadequate: Regrettably, there are a wide range of elements that can lead to insufficient airflow. We will require to perform a extensive evaluation in order to figure out whether the problem is the outcome of a blocked air filter, an problem with the blower, frozen evaporator coils, dripping ductwork, or blocked duct.
  • You observe that there is a substantial amount of wetness in the area around your unit: Condensation is a natural incident, nevertheless it shouldn’t be present in extreme quantities. It is possible that you have a dripping refrigerant or a stopped up drain tube if you discover any excess moisture or pooling water in the location.
  • Weird Noises from Your Unit: It is to be anticipated for an air conditioning unit to create some background noise while it is running. On the other hand, if it starts making audible shrieking, screeching, grinding, groaning, or scraping noises, this is an obvious indication that something requires to be repaired.
  • It appears that there is a issue with your thermostat: It’s possible that the thermostat is the source of the issues you’re having with your air conditioning unit. If you have cold and hot areas around your home, your unit will not shut off, or it won’t begin, it could be because of a problem with the thermostat. If your unit will not start, it might also be due to the fact that it won’t turn off.
  • Foul odors are coming from your system: There might be a issue with your AC if you smell anything burning or a moldy smell. These smells can be brought on by a range of elements, consisting of mold advancement and charred wiring.
  • Your system turns often between the following states: When the temperature level inside your home reaches the level that you have chosen on the thermostat, a/c are programmed to turn off immediately. Regardless of this, it will continue to cycle even when there is something wrong with it.

The HVAC System Is Making Weird Noises

There are a couple of noises that must not be heard coming from air conditioners despite the fact that they do not operate in full silence. These noises might be anything from a banging to a screeching to a grinding to a clicking noise. These particular sounds generally suggest that there is a problem within the air conditioning unit that needs to be fixed by a expert of in Johnson County.

Sounds that are Weird and Different Coming From Your AC The following should be included:

  • Banging: The issue is generally the compressor in an air conditioning system that is making a banging sound. This part of the a/c unit is responsible for delivering refrigerant to the numerous other elements of the system in order to get rid of excess heat from your home. Compressor components might loosen up as the air conditioner system ages. This noise is triggered by the parts walking around and rattling and banging into one another.
  • Screeching: A broken blower fan motor within the air conditioner may produce a sound comparable to shrieking or squealing if the motor is working poorly. Generally, a malfunctioning fan belt or broken bearings in the motor are to blame for this sound. Shut off the air conditioner right away and contact a professional for repairs whenever you hear a shrieking sound.
  • Grinding: The sound of something grinding is never a good sign to hear originating from any type of mechanical things. Pistons inside the compressor may have broken, which might result in this grinding noise emanating from the a/c. When a compressor’s pistons become worn, it almost always indicates that the compressor itself has to be replaced. The total air conditioner unit could need to be changed depending on the model of AC and how old it is.
  • Clicking: It is extremely typical for an ac system to make a clicking sound when it at first switches on. If you hear clicking throughout the entire period of the cooling cycle, then there is a problem with the clicking. These clicks are the outcome of a thermostat that is not working effectively.
